Ticket: Staging env misconfigured for Siftgate bloom filter

The bloom layer in front of the Pellet KV store is rejecting all lookups in staging because the env file was copied from the dev template without credentials. False-positive tuning values are fine; only the auth line is missing. To unblock the weekly demo, the Pellet admission secret must be set on the following line.

env line for yaguf-fajop: LEDGER_TOKEN13=fb08984397349

Ticket: Spreadsheet export holds entire workbook in memory. When exporting ledgers over 200k rows in Tallyvane, heap usage climbs past 3 GB and the worker gets OOM-killed. The XLSX writer buffers all sheets before flushing; we should switch to streaming row-by-row. Repro steps documented in the attached notes. The failing build's token appears below for reference.

session token of tajef-bageg = htk21_5d90d574934f3ccae6437

A: The regression stems from a cardinality estimator change that undercounts rows in partitioned tables with sparse statistics. From a security standpoint, the impact is availability-only: no data exposure occurs, but degraded plans can exhaust worker pools and trigger timeout cascades in dependent services. We have pinned the estimator to legacy mode via a session flag and scheduled a statistics refresh across all Quarrel clusters. If you need the audit trail or reproduction steps for your review, request them here.

escalation mailbox, bafog-fafog: ulador@paliqlabs.internal